The development of a security system is generally performed through a multiphase methodology, starting from the initial preliminary analisys of the application environment, up to the physical implementation of the security mechanisms. In this framework, we propose a new approach for the development of security systems based on the reuse of existing security specifications. In the paper we illustrate how reusable specifications can be built by analyzing existing security systems, and how they can be used to develop new security systems not from scratch.
